是通过将当前环境中的变量值保存到一个文件中,以便在其他Shell脚本中使用这些变量值。这在配置和部署应用程序时非常有用。
在Shell脚本中,可以使用以下命令将环境变量值导入到文件中:
printenv > env_vars.txt
上述命令将通过printenv
命令获取当前环境中的所有变量,并将其输出重定向到一个名为env_vars.txt
的文件中。你也可以选择性地导出指定的环境变量,如下所示:
echo "VAR1=$VAR1" > env_vars.txt
echo "VAR2=$VAR2" >> env_vars.txt
上述命令中,VAR1
和VAR2
是要导出的环境变量的名称。第一个命令使用单个>
符号将变量值覆盖写入到env_vars.txt
文件中,而第二个命令使用>>
符号将变量值追加到文件末尾。
在应用场景中,将环境变量值导入文件Shell脚本可以用于以下情况:
对于腾讯云用户,可以使用腾讯云提供的云服务器(CVM)来运行Shell脚本,并使用腾讯云对象存储(COS)来存储导出的环境变量文件。腾讯云的CVM和COS产品提供了高性能、可靠性和安全性的解决方案,适用于各种云计算场景。
希望以上回答能够满足你的需求。
领取专属 10元无门槛券
手把手带您无忧上云